West Bank has become Israel's garbage can
Green groups warned on Thursday that the occupied West Bank’s ecosystem is reaching a point of no return.
Environmentalists came together on Thursday at Tel Aviv University’s Porter School of Environmental Studies to discuss the most pressing issues plaguing the ecosystem of the West Bank and to strategize solutions.
The conference was organized by a variety of green groups, according to the Zionist daily Jerusalem Post.
The occupied West Bank "have become the garbage can of the state; the pollution there is a disaster that will harm millions," “If decision makers do not wake up, within a few years, citizens of Judea and Samaria will suffer from serious environmental pollution,”.
